Sheffield United and Barnsley have informally agreed a price for Chris O’Grady, the Sheffield Star has revealed. It is known that O’Grady is on Nigel Clough’s wishlist for this summer and it is thought that he and Danny Wilson have both agreed a price that would be acceptable for the striker. No concrete bid has been made yet, however, and O’Grady’s demands in terms of his contract could be decisive – as the powerful front-man has already turned down a move to Charlton over the course of this transfer window. http://hereisthecity.com/en-gb/2014...rmack-speaks-after-leeds-exit-sheffield-uni/?
